在Cassandra中處理時間序列數據時,一般可以使用以下幾種方法:
使用時間戳作為行鍵:可以將時間戳作為行鍵,這樣可以方便按時間范圍查詢數據。
使用時間戳作為列名:可以將時間戳作為列名,然后將數據存儲在列值中。這樣可以方便按時間順序或倒序查詢數據。
使用時間片進行數據分片:可以將時間序列數據分成不同的時間片,然后將每個時間片存儲在不同的表中。這樣可以提高查詢性能,避免單表數據量過大。
使用時間戳作為索引:可以在數據表中創建索引,使用時間戳作為索引字段。這樣可以加快查詢速度,提高檢索效率。
總的來說,在處理時間序列數據時,需要根據具體的業務需求和查詢需求來選擇合適的數據模型和查詢方式。同時,需要注意數據分布均衡和查詢性能的優化。